Excellent opportunity opens for a Relationship Manager to join a growing International Bank. The role offers the opportunity to take ownership of a portfolio of international and expat clients, managing relationships from initial onboarding through to long-term development. Acting as a trusted advisor, you will support clients with complex, cross-border banking needs while driving portfolio growth through tailored financial conversations and the identification of relevant product opportunities. You will work closely with internal stakeholders across product, operations, compliance and onboarding teams to deliver a seamless and high-quality client experience, while also contributing to the continuous improvement of client journeys, service models and digital engagement strategies.
Main Responsibilities
- Client Relationship Management
- Act as the primary point of contact for onboarded clients, delivering a high-quality, seamless experience
- Build and maintain strong client relationships through proactive engagement and regular follow-ups
- Support new clients through onboarding, including welcome calls and guidance on services and products
- Portfolio Management & Growth
- Manage a portfolio of expat/international clients, monitoring behaviour, needs and opportunities
- Identify and execute cross-sell opportunities aligned with client profiles and regulatory requirements
- Drive growth in deposits and client liabilities through needs-based conversations
- Client Service & Experience
- Deliver responsive and professional support to client enquiries
- Take ownership of issue resolution, coordinating internally where required
- Monitor client satisfaction and act on feedback to improve service delivery
- Compliance & Risk Management
- Ensure all client interactions comply with regulatory requirements and internal policies
- Maintain accurate and up-to-date client records, including KYC and documentation
- Identify and escalate any risks, unusual activity or compliance concerns
- Collaboration & Reporting
- Work closely with internal teams to ensure smooth client servicing
- Provide insights from client interactions to support product and service improvements
- Track and report on client activity, engagement and portfolio performance
- Continuous Improvement
- Contribute to process, service and digital journey enhancements
- Stay up to date with product knowledge, regulatory changes and industry best practices
Main Requirements
- Arab Speaker Required
- Bachelor's degree in Finance, Economics, Business Administration, Accounting or related field
- Relevant professional certifications (e.g. CISI, CII, CeMAP) are advantageous
Experience & Skills
- 5+ 7 years' experience in client relationship management within banking, wealth management or financial services
- Proven experience managing client portfolios, including retention and growth of assets or liabilities
- Experience working with international or high-net-worth clients, ideally with cross-border exposure
- Strong understanding of banking products (e.g. deposits, FX, mortgages, savings)
- Solid knowledge of regulatory frameworks including KYC, AML and client suitability
- Strong relationship-building and communication skills
- Commercial mindset with the ability to identify growth opportunities
- High attention to detail and strong organisational skills
- Ability to manage multiple client relationships effectively
- Collaborative approach with the ability to work across teams
- Strong risk awareness and commitment to compliance
